Map Loyalty Promotion Requirements to Global Promotions Management Features
In addition to standard capabilities, Global Promotions Management supports specific
requirements for loyalty programs. Use this mapping to identify the features that help you meet
your loyalty program business requirements.
Required Editions
Available in: Lightning Experience
Available in: Enterprise, Performance, Unlimited,
and Developer Editions with Loyalty Management
Run promotions that offer rewards for a specific activity of the loyalty
member
Use the Accrual Events promotion template and select the type of accrual activity
that you want to reward members for.
The Accrual Events promotion template is
available on the Select Promotion Template step in the Quick Promotion guided
flow.
Run promotions that offer rewards when loyalty program members complete a set of
activity-driven milestones
Use the Engagement Trail promotion template and select the activities and
targets that you want to reward members for.
The Engagement Trail promotion template is available on the Select Promotion
Template step in the Quick Promotion guided flow.
